162 Lynch Street, Brooklyn, NY 11206
The 6-unit, 3-story residential building at 162 Lynch Street in Williamsburg, owned by Juda Jungreis, has maintained its status as an OLD LAW TENEMENT structure since its 1931 construction.
The property has a concerning pattern of unresolved violations related to bedbug reporting compliance, with four consecutive Housing Maintenance Code violations from 2021 through 2024, all specifically citing the owner's failure to file the required annual bedbug reports with the HPD as mandated by § HMC.
More recently, there remains an active Department of Buildings violation from November 2019 pertaining to the failure to file the annual boiler inspection report for 2017, which has not yet been resolved. While the building has a history dating back to 1931, these recent and ongoing violations suggest potential lapses in regulatory compliance that could impact resident safety and comfort, particularly regarding pest management and equipment maintenance.
